The wrongful conviction of Kirk Bloodsworth highlighted critical flaws in 1980s footwear impression analysis, specifically the lack of statistical quantification. At that time, experts relied on subjective visual comparisons, asserting that a match was unique based solely on qualitative similarities. This method lacked a scientific way to calculate the probability of a random match, often leading to overstated claims of certainty that misled juries into believing a shoe print was as unique as a fingerprint.
Modern forensic standards have evolved to prioritize empirical data over subjective opinion. Contemporary footwear analysis incorporates statistical modeling and database comparisons to provide a mathematical likelihood of a match. Experts now distinguish between class characteristics, which are common to all shoes of a certain model, and individual characteristics, which are unique wear patterns. Furthermore, the transition from qualitative assessment to quantitative analysis ensures that forensic evidence is presented with clearly defined error rates. These advancements in methodology and statistical rigor help prevent the overstatement of evidentiary strength, providing a more reliable framework for judicial decision making.
